What are incubators and how do they support start-ups?

by innoWerft | Feb 14, 2024 | Glossary entry

Incubators are specialised institutions or programmes that support startups in their early stages of development by providing access to resources such as office space, mentoring, networks and sometimes seed capital.

What is the hockey stick effect, and why is it significant for start-ups?

by innoWerft | Feb 14, 2024 | Glossary entry

The hockey stick effect describes a growth curve in the economy, and particularly in start-ups, that shows a sudden and sharp increase after initially moderate growth, similar to the shape of a hockey stick.

What is a hackathon, and how does it promote innovation?

by innoWerft | Feb 14, 2024 | Glossary entry

A hackathon is an intensive event, often lasting several days, at which programmers, designers and entrepreneurs come together to work in teams on the development of new software solutions, products or services.

What is growth hacking and why is it relevant for start-ups?

by innoWerft | Feb 14, 2024 | Glossary entry

Growth hacking is a marketing technique used by start-ups to achieve rapid growth and user acquisition with creative, cost-effective strategies.
